A Letter From The Sugar Plum Fairy

Dear Aspiring Ballerinas,

With Nutcracker performances right around the corner, this is such a fun and exciting time, but it is also a time for hard work and sacrifice. This year we have been given the exciting opportunity to perform the principle role of the Sugar Plum Fairy in The Joffrey Ballet School’s production of The Nutcracker. It’s been a difficult and exhausting process, but also a very rewarding one. There have been times when we weren’t sure how the role was going to come together. Days when we were sore and tired and felt like nothing was working,. These times truly test your ability as a dancer. The times when you must push through even though you feel you can’t. These are the moments you become stronger.

Student Spotlight: Bald Ballerina Maggie Kudirka Grande Jetes Over Cancer

We recently sat down with our very own, Maggie Kudirka, the Bald Ballerina. A dancer in our Joffrey Ballet Concert Group, Maggie was diagnosed with stage four breast cancer in June 2014 at the age of 23. In this intimate interview we discuss her journey from diagnoses to today and what she hopes to accomplish with her new initiative. Take a look!
